How to use ChatGPT in Software Testing

ChatGPT has emerged as a powerful tool in the field of software testing, offering innovative ways to enhance and streamline various testing processes. Here’s how you can effectively leverage ChatGPT in your software testing workflow:

  • Test Case Generation: One of ChatGPT’s most significant applications in software testing is its ability to generate test cases based on the requirements of the application under test. This can be particularly helpful when dealing with complex systems or when you need to create a comprehensive set of test scenarios quickly.
  • Test Script Creation: ChatGPT can assist in generating test scripts based on predefined test cases. This feature can significantly reduce the time and effort required in manual script writing, especially for repetitive or straightforward test scenarios.
  • Test Plan Development: The AI can help in creating detailed test plans, outlining testing strategies, and defining test objectives. This can provide a solid foundation for your testing process and ensure comprehensive coverage.
  • Bug Report Generation: ChatGPT can assist in creating well-structured and detailed bug reports. By providing the AI with the necessary information about a discovered issue, it can help format the report clearly and concisely.
  • Test Data Generation: The AI can generate realistic test data for various scenarios, helping testers cover a wide range of possible inputs and edge cases.
  • Automated Test Result Analysis: ChatGPT can generate reports summarizing the results of automated tests, making it easier for testers to identify issues and prioritize their efforts.
  • Performance Testing Assistance: While ChatGPT can’t directly perform performance tests, it can help plan performance test scenarios, generate load patterns, and interpret test results.
  • Security Testing Support: ChatGPT can help identify potential security vulnerabilities by suggesting common attack vectors or security testing scenarios based on the application’s description.

To effectively use ChatGPT in software testing, it’s crucial to formulate clear and concise prompts for each testing scenario or question. Be specific about what you want to achieve and provide relevant context about the application under test.

While ChatGPT is a powerful tool, it’s important to remember that it should be used as an assistant rather than a replacement for human expertise. Always review and validate the outputs provided by ChatGPT to ensure accuracy and relevance to your specific testing context.

By integrating ChatGPT into your software testing processes, you can potentially increase efficiency, improve test coverage, and free up valuable time for testers to focus on more complex and critical aspects of quality assurance.
